I can understand wanting to secure a special character dining experience for this occasion and
Goofy's Kitchen and
Minnie & Friends - Breakfast In the Park at Plaza Inn, are great options. Dining reservations can be made up to 60 days in advance on the
Disneyland website or through the Disneyland Mobile App, so you are well within your window to find something tasty! In either case, I recommend tapping the magnifying glass search icon and typing "Goofy's Kitchen" or "Plaza Inn". If you are on the website, tap the "Check Available Days" button. If you are in the app, tap "Reserve Dining". In both cases, you will then enter your party size and preferred date and time to view availability.

Guests are always changing their plans, and it's possible that a reservation may pop up, especially as you get closer to your park day. Both restaurants require Guests to cancel two hours ahead of their reservation. In my experience, most Guests are making their final decisions on plans in the 24 hours leading up to their park day, so you may see some movement.

Disneyland Resort knows how to make Guests feel extra special, so my first tip would be to grab a complimentary "I'm Celebrating" button as soon as you arrive. The Cast Members at most merchandise locations will have these on hand and, if not, will point you in the right direction. Your princess be showered with well wishes throughout the day!
My next tip would be to make an alternative reservation at one of the dining locations that offers a
Mickey Mouse Celebration Cake. The best part is, you can easily add this to your reservation when you are making the reservation itself! It couldn't be easier, and, speaking from experience, the cake is as delicious as it is cute! Currently, Blue Bayou, Café Orléans, Lamplight Lounge, River Belle Terrace, and Wine Country Trattoria offer this special treat.
